Anyone else keep their home text-free? No visible words, logos, or packaging
I have a preference and I'm curious if others share it or if there's a name for it.
I like having no visible text in my house. No books left in sight (or just a meaningful one), no brand names or logos on appliances, no product packaging on display. Anything with words on it either gets stored away or debranded.
It's more about the visual quiet. Text pulls at my attention, books especially. So a room with no words in it just feels calmer to me, and I find deep focus much easier to reach there, for creative work.
